Australia win their first T20 World Cup after eight-wicket victory over New Zealand

  • Australia 173-2; beat New Zealand 172-4 by eight wickets
  • Mitchell Marsh hits unbeaten to win final

A 92-run second-wicket partnership between David Warner and Mitchell Marsh set Australia up to win the T20 World Cup final against New Zealand by eight wickets.

The two came together with the score on 15, before blasting away the Black Caps bowlers as Australia eased to the 173 target with an over to spare.
